Telecom regulator Trai is clashing with the Department of Telecom over satellite spectrum charges. Trai objects to DoT's proposal for lower charges for state-owned BSNL, deeming it discriminatory to new entrants. Trai argues that preferential treatment for BSNL, even for strategic purposes, is unfair given evolving market dynamics and the need for a level playing field.

India has firmly rejected Bangladesh's interim government's assertions, stating New Delhi consistently supports free, fair, and inclusive elections in the neighboring country. India denied allowing its territory to be used for activities hostile to Bangladesh's interests and called on Dhaka to ensure internal law and order for peaceful elections.
